Default 3/6 River Straight - Raise or not?

Another checkup from the weekend. Live 3/6. Only here 2 orbits, but looks like a typical loose passive table. Most want to see the flop, and won't raise without the goods.

2 folds to a raiser. MP calls, button calls, I look down at

Q [img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img] 9 [img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img] and I call. (8 SB)

Flop: 7 [img]/images/graemlins/spade.gif[/img] 8 [img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img] 10 [img]/images/graemlins/spade.gif[/img]

I check, PF Raiser bets, MP folds, button calls, I call. (5.5 BB)

Turn 2 [img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img]

I check, PF Raiser bets, button calls, I call. (8.5 SB)

River 6 [img]/images/graemlins/spade.gif[/img]

I check, PFR bets, button calls, I raise (????)

Now, is the river raise just spewing, or standard? I had the odds to chase, and I got there, but so did the flush.

I read PFR for a big pair or a big A, and he obviously didn't like the river and made a little whince when it hit.

I figured button would have raised if he made his flush instead of trying for an overcall (just didn't think he was that sophisticated). Likewise, he would have raised earlier if he had a higher straight.

Can I trust reads like this at 3/6, or just be safe, call, and hope to take a nice pot?

Also, anyone find a raise anywhere else? Flop, maybe?
